Different Patterns in Snow Chains

Conventionally, these chains had ladder-like patterns. However, the pattern has become more aggressive with diamond or Z structures. Indeed, the newer patterns are capable of providing better performance. Studies reveal that the Z patterned snow chains offer improved traction in most places.

Fact: You must appreciate the fact that snow chains cannot be used everywhere. In some states of USA, these chains are completely prohibited.

Choosing the Right Snow Chain

Moving on, you must choose the right snow chain for your vehicle. There are so many destined conditions to influence your choice. The tire configuration, the model of your vehicle, the actual size and overall weight of the vehicle plays an important role in your pick. That is because these parameters decide how much traction is required for your vehicle.
